FX Impact, 25 cal, MK2, PP, 700mm barrel, out of the box factory assembled, I did not do any allenkey tweaking. Only Lazer the centershot for the scope inline.
All factory default FX single hole transfer port, pellet probe, orings.
JSB 25 cal, King Heavy pellets, 33.95 grains.
Fill pressure 213 bar, regulator pressure just 3 hairs below 100 (whatever that means at the moment), only thing I replaced the FX gauge to Wika.
Shot a very first 10 pellet set, only to settle the orings a bit. I feel a bit of kick from the hammer, I will work on it next.
